Bank caves to Trump pressure, betraying Parkland survivors who inspired the groundbreaking corporate responsibility measure
WASHINGTON, D.C., June 3, 2025 — Today, March For Our Lives condemned Citigroup’s shameful decision to cave to Trump administration pressure and abandon its 2018 gun safety policy that restricted banking services to retailers selling firearms to people under 21.
